The safety of your pet is of the utmost importance to me. In addition to having a designated Safety Plan, here are a few things I do to ensure your pet is protected: -open doors slowly and just enough for me to get through so your pet can't -utilize second barriers like baby gates to assist with the above -supervise your pet while outside -scan to make sure there is nothing harmful within your pet's reach and if so, move it -give your pet the space they need to feel comfortable -learn about any triggers your pet may have -inspect collars and leashes for any signs of wear and tear -double check locks and security systems -monitor your pet's health signs and signals like breathing, appetite, and physical condition

Cat s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a cat sitter in Bonnie Bell on Rover as of May 2025 was about $30 per night,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A cat sitter’s rate may also change as you customize your booking to fit your and your cat’s needs.
As of May 2025, there are 162 cat sitters in Bonnie Bell. You can filter, sort, expand your radius, read reviews, and compare pricing to find the perfect cat sitter near you. As a reminder, cat sitters joining Rover must pass a background check for you and your cat’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to reach out to multiple cat sitters about your booking. Typically, 87% of Bonnie Bell cat sitters respond in under an hour.
Cat sitters in Bonnie Bell have an average of 17 years of experience. Cat sitters with repeat customers have an average of 6 repeat clients.
